Compare all specifications:
2001 Audi A4 | 1995 Infiniti G20 | |
Make | Audi | Infiniti |
Model | A4 | G20 |
Year Released | 2001 | 1995 |
Body Type | Station Wagon |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2976 cc | 1998 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Horse Power | 248 HP | 141 HP |
Engine RPM | 6300 RPM | 6400 RPM |
Torque | 330 Nm | 182 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3200 RPM | 4800 RPM |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1515 kg | 1245 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4550 mm | 4450 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1770 mm | 1700 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1430 mm | 1400 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2660 mm | 2560 mm |
